Sauber: We are happy about this result

24 March, 2013 Nico Hulkenberg The Malaysian Grand Prix brought the first four points for the Sauber F1 Team in the second race of the new season. At the beginning the track in Sepang was wet, and all the drivers started the race on intermediate tyres. However, after only a few laps they changed to dry tyres. The race was extremely demanding for tyres and, as a result, the specators saw a lot of pit stops. Both Sauber F1 Team drivers changed tyres four times. Nico Hülkenberg finished eighth, Esteban Gutiérrez came in 12th.
